Moderate #10V566000 Plain English
Component

EQUIPMENT:ELECTRICAL:NAVIGATIONAL SYSTEM(GLOBAL POSITIONING SYSTEM)

Manufacturer
VOLVO CARS OF N.A. LLC.
What Happened
The portable GPS unit in your car is a small device that helps you navigate. It's made by Garmin and is connected to your vehicle's electrical system. In some cases, the device's battery can overheat.
Risk if Unfixed
If the battery overheats, it could catch fire. This could cause damage to your car's electrical system or even a fire in your vehicle.
Free Fix
You should stop using the Garmin portable GPS unit right away. Your Volvo dealer will replace the battery with a new one and add a protective spacer, all at no cost to you. This service is free, so don't hesitate to schedule it as soon as possible.
Show original NHTSA language
Original — What Happened
VOLVO IS RECALLING CERTAIN V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H GARMIN 760 PORTABLE GLOBAL POSITIONING SYSTEM (GPS) UNITS BECAUSE THE BATTERIES ON THOSE UNITS MAY OVERHEAT.
Original — Risk if Unfixed
AN OVERHEATED BATTERY COULD LEAD TO A FIRE.
Original — Remedy
VOLVO ADVISES OWNERS TO PLEASE STOP USING THE GARMIN PORTABLE GPS DEVICE IMMEDIATELY, AND VISIT THE GARMIN WEBSITE TO DETERMINE IF THEIR UNIT IS AFFECTED. THE UNIT'S BATTERY WILL BE REPLACED WITH A NEW BATTERY AND A SPACER WILL BE INSERTED ON TOP OF THE BATTERY NEXT TO THE PCB. THIS SERVICE WILL BE PERFORMED FREE OF CHARGE. THE SAFETY RECALL BEGAN ON NOVEMBER 18, 2010. OWNERS MAY CONTACT GARMIN AT 866-957-1981 OR VISIT GARMIN'S WEBSITE AT WWW.GARMIN.COM/NUVIBATTERYPCBRECALL.

Low Priority #06V375000 Plain English
Component

EQUIPMENT:OTHER:LABELS

Manufacturer
VOLVO CARS OF N.A. LLC.
What Happened
The tire information label on your vehicle has incorrect information about tire inflation and loading. This label is like a guide that helps you know how much weight your tires can handle and how much air to put in them.
Risk if Unfixed
If you rely on this incorrect label, you might put too much weight in your vehicle or underinflate your tires, which could cause a tire to fail while you're driving, increasing the risk of a crash.
Free Fix
Your Volvo dealer will send you the correct label for free, so you can safely use your vehicle. There's no need to visit the dealer in person, they'll mail the correct label to you.
Show original NHTSA language
Original — What Happened
CERTAIN VEHICLES FAIL TO CONFORM TO THE REQUIREMENTS OF FEDERAL MOTOR VEHICLE SAFETY STANDARD NO. 110, "TIRE SELECTION AND RIMS." THE LABEL DENOTING THE TIRE AND LOADING PRESSURE INFORMATION IS INCORRECT.
Original — Risk if Unfixed
A MISPRINTED LABEL WOULD LEAD TO IMPROPER VEHICLE LOADING SPECIFICATIONS OR TIRE INFLATION WHICH COULD RESULT IN A TIRE FAILURE, INCREASING THE RISK OF A CRASH.
Original — Remedy
DEALERS WILL MAIL THE CORRECT LABELS F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L BEGAN ON DECEMBER 18, 2006. OWNERS MAY CONTACT VOLVO AT 1-800-458-1552.
